Belgium Upcoming Match Schedule - FIFA World Cup 2026 Group G

Belgium will play in Group G with Egypt and Iran, as well as New Zealand. The group stage games will be played in the West Coast of the United States and Canada.

Group G Match Schedule

DateMatchVenueCity
June 15, 2026Belgium vs. EgyptLumen FieldSeattle, USA
June 21, 2026Belgium vs. IranSoFi Stadium (Los Angeles Stadium)Los Angeles, USA
June 26, 2026New Zealand vs. BelgiumBC PlaceVancouver, Canada

Belgium face Egypt in their first matches of the tournament at Seattle's Lumen Field on June 15 in what will be one of the most interesting individual showdowns so far in the group stage – with Kevin De Bruyne facing off against Mohamed Salah. Their second match takes them to Los Angeles to play Iran on June 21 and then the group finishes with a trip north to Vancouver to take on New Zealand on June 26.

The top two teams in each group and eight of the eight best third place finishers make the cut, moving on to the round of 32. Belgium (the number one country in the group) are expected to progress but there are no guarantees at a World Cup.

The Golden Era: 1986 and 2018

Before the modern golden age of the Belgian side, the ' best ever World Cup performance before that was their semi-final loss to Argentina in Mexico 1986 which saw them finish in 4th place, the top finish ever at that time.

However, nothing was more captivating to the world than Russia 2018. Roberto Martínez's Belgium team was possibly the strongest that has ever lined up and finished in 3rd place after defeating England 2-0 in the third place play-off to win the medal. The triumph over a much favoured Brazil side in the quarter-final, the goal coming from an incredible counter-attacking move, is still one of the most noted moments in Belgian football history.

The Qatar Disappointment

The Qatar 2022 World Cup has been a lesson in the harsh truth. Ranked second in the world going in, Belgium mustered just one win from their three group matches and exited at the group stage for the first time since 1998. The performance was a good sign of the end of the golden generation era and brought significant changes to the squad and management.

The 1930 Beginning

Belgium were one of 13 countries to take part in the first FIFA World Cup in 1930 in Uruguay and were eliminated in the quarter-final against Uruguay 1–0. That showed a lot for a country that would have an impact on the game for the next several decades.
